The Liverpool City Region has named Tiffany St James as the UK's first regional Chief AI Officer. Her role will involve leading a taskforce focused on the ethical integration of artificial intelligence across various public sectors. This appointment marks a significant step in the region's goal to become a global leader in 'AI for Good', emphasizing the responsible development and application of AI.

New Leadership for Ethical AI Development
Tiffany St James brings significant experience to her new position. She is a member of the Global AI Council. Her past work includes collaborating with Sir Tim Berners-Lee on the creation of Data.gov.uk. This background positions her to guide the Liverpool City Region in its AI ambitions.
Her appointment follows a detailed national recruitment process. The region sought a leader who could combine technical expertise with a strong understanding of ethical implications. The aim is to ensure that AI serves the community's best interests.
"I’m thrilled to join the Liverpool City Region – a place with bold ambition and heart," Tiffany St James stated. "This role offers a unique opportunity in public sector innovation to shape how ethical AI transforms lives, from education to healthcare."

Mayor Rotheram on AI's Potential
Liverpool City Region Mayor Steve Rotheram highlighted the significant opportunities AI presents. He noted the recent multi-billion-pound investments in AI across the UK. He believes this puts the Liverpool City Region in a strong position.
Mayor Rotheram emphasized the importance of harnessing AI correctly. He stressed that it must be used as a force for good. The region's strategy is to improve public services, support communities, and foster economic growth through AI.

Setting a Global Standard for Regional AI
Mayor Rotheram praised Tiffany St James's extensive experience. He mentioned her work with global tech leaders and her role in national digital strategies. He described her as a "trailblazer" necessary to lead this initiative.
Her appointment is seen as a clear indicator of the region's ambition. The Mayor is confident that St James will help set new standards. These standards will demonstrate how regions worldwide can effectively use AI for their residents' benefit.
"Artificial Intelligence has the potential to be one of the defining technologies of our age – but only if it’s harnessed in the right way," Mayor Steve Rotheram said. "That’s why we’re putting a clear focus on using it as a force for good – to improve public services, support our communities, and grow our economy."
